17) Honey-Sriracha salmon foil packets

Servings: 4 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 1 1/2 lb salmon fillet cut into four pieces
  • 2 tbsp honey
  • 1 tbsp Sriracha reduce for milder heat
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tsp sesame oil
  • 1 lemon sliced
  • 1 cup of thinly sliced zucchini or snap peas
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tbsp chopped green onion for garnish

Method
 

  1. Heat your grill to medium-high (about 400*F). Tear four pieces of foil large enough to make a seal.
  2. In a small bowl, mix together honey, Sriracha, soy sauce, and sesame oil.
  3. On each piece of foil, put a piece of salmon. Add salt and pepper for seasoning. Then put some veggies and a slice of lemon on top.
  4. Spoon the sauce over each fillet and fold the foil to seal it completely.
  5. Grill packets for 10-12 minutes. Salmon is ready when it flakes with a fork. Be careful when opening; steam is hot!
